Домой Каталог: Дополнения WP-Recall Freelance WP-Recall Вывод заданий в личном кабинете (Freelance биржа)
66ответ(ов) в теме
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
31
15:10

потому что ?user=1&tab=zadaniya_76 это get-параметры, которые также надо передавать с формы фильтра, для этого код формы надо дополнить указанием их текущих значений путем размещения скрытых полей с этими значениями:

<input type="hidden" name="user" value="<?php echo $_GET['user']; ?>">
<input type="hidden" name="tab" value="zadaniya_76">

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
32
15:30

А для если для совсем тупых )) куда вставлять данный код по точнее ?

0
Вова (Otshelnik-Fm)
не в сети 4 дня
На сайте с 27.01.2013
Участник
Тем 43
Сообщения 18654
33
15:35

рядом с другими полями input внутри формы form

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
34
15:55

Хрен, всё равно открывается новая страница.

Вы не можете просматривать опубликованные ссылки
0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
35
16:13

значит делаете неверно

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
36
18:00

Если можете разжуйте куда вставлять и как должно выглядеть. Ни черта не могу понять.

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
37
18:03

вставляйте в хтмл код формы - тут что то непонятно?
Если не получается описывайте свои действия и что именно не понятно.

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
38
18:06

Открыл index.php, нашел строку function get_freelance_task_filter(){ ?> сюда вставил ссылку где должны выводиться задания после фильтрации . А вот куда это ... <input type="hidden" name="user" value="">

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
39
18:09

Сергей сказал(а)
А вот куда это ...

да куда хотите, но в пределах тега form, например, перед тегом </form>

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
40
18:15

Делал -

Вы не можете просматривать опубликованные ссылки

При нажатии фильтровать открывается новая пустая страница

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
41
18:45

какой урл у страницы которая открывается?

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
42
17:33

Андрей, так и не получилось. На новую чистую страницу все таки перебрасывает. Скрин куда вставил в предыдущем сообщении.

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
43
17:35

Сергей сказал(а)
так и не получилось

"не получилось" - ни о чем не говорит, описывайте что именно делали, скидывайте код, если надо и отвечайте на вопросы которые задают

Андрей CS сказал(а)
какой урл у страницы которая открывается?

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
44
17:39

Открывает -

Вы не можете просматривать опубликованные ссылки

<input type="hidden" name="user" value="">

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
45
17:49

ну все правильно, данные, которые передаются через размещенные скрытые поля в адресную строку передаются

Сергей сказал(а)
user=1&tab=zadaniya_76

другое дело, что все данные передаются на главную страницу, а не на страницу профиля, прописывайте верный адрес страницы профиля в атрибуте action

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
46
18:00

Изменил на это - account/?user=1&tab=zadaniya_76 , теперь после нажатия на фильтровать остается на этой вкладке, но фильтрация Не Происходит. Помимо этого задания принимают вот такой вид. В фильтре я выбрал закрытые заказы - и вот один закрытый какой был принял такой вид -

Вы не можете просматривать опубликованные ссылки
0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
47
18:06

Если фильтрация не происходит значит цикл формирующий вывод заданий игнорирует переданные фильтром данные, цикл во вкладке размещали вы сами, почему не происходит фильтрация, а также почему едет верстка видимо вам виднее.

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
48
18:09

Выводил фильтр с помощью шорткода [myshortcode]
function my_shortcode_function() {
return get_freelance_task_filter();
}
add_shortcode('myshortcode', 'my_shortcode_function');

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
49
18:11

А сами задания [ic_add_posts post_type='task']

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
50
18:16

Сергей сказал(а)
А сами задания [ic_add_posts post_type='task']

я должен знать что это за шорткод?
задания должны выводится полноценным циклом

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
51
18:17

Как выглядит весь цикл ?

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
52
18:19

что то вроде этого

<?php if (have_posts()) : ?>
    <?php while (have_posts()) : the_post(); ?>    
        <!-- атрибуты записи ... -->
    <?php endwhile; ?>
<?php endif; ?>

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
53
18:20

Задания после фильтрации дублируются.

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
54
18:22

Сергей сказал(а)
Задания после фильтрации дублируются.

видимо проблема в цикле вывода

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
55
18:38

Ок, думаю доберусь до истины. Она постоянно где то рядом ) Я уже как то задавал вопрос по поводу данной записи как её удалить. Так как комментарий фрилансера не требуется. Может как то выключить данную функцию можно ? Эта запись оказывается лишней.

Вы не можете просматривать опубликованные ссылки
0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
56
18:41

Сергей сказал(а)
Я уже как то задавал вопрос по поводу данной записи как её удалить. Так как комментарий фрилансера не требуется. Может как то выключить данную функцию можно ?

можно только вырезать функцию вывода формы комментирования из шаблона вывода записи

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
57
18:43

Я не нашел как выглядит данная функция уже искал.

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
58
18:46

выглядит так

comment_form();

0
Сергей
не в сети 7 лет
На сайте с 13.09.2016
Участник
Тем 29
Сообщения 146
59
18:47

В том же файле index.php ?

0
Андрей CS
не в сети 3 дня
На сайте с 30.11.-0001
Администратор
Тем 71
Сообщения 16936
60
18:52

всегда было в файле comments.php

0
Вы не имеете права на публикацию сообщений в этой теме